Jet2.com launches New Ski Routes for Edinburgh and NewcastleMonday 23, August 2010

Jet2.com launches ski flights to Geneva from just 29.99 one way including taxes. Jet2.com has expanded its ski offering from Edinburgh and Newcastle with the launch today of brand new services to Geneva for the 2010/2011 winter sports season.
The new services will operate during peak winter getaway times with Newcastle flights departing from 26thDecember to 9th January and then from 20th February to 27th March. The new Edinburgh service will operate from 20th February to 27th March. Flights are on sale now from just £29.99 one way including taxes.
Geneva is the ideal destination for the North’s ski and snow board lovers with breathtaking scenery, outstanding restaurants and world class entertainment. As well as being a skiers paradise, it is also reputed to be one of the most beautiful and cultural cities in Europe.
Philip Meeson, boss of Jet2.com, said: “Our winter ski flights are extremely popular, with the UK’s ski and snow board enthusiasts unable to resist their annual fix of Europe’s snow-capped mountains. With this growing demand we have increased our services from the north for this season, giving people in the region an even greater choice of winter holiday destination.”
